The basic piece of clothing, which you receive at the beginning of the game, is not the best protection against the hordes of the enemies that you will have to face. For that reason, at the very beginning, you should better equip yourself with a basic armor.

The main use of armor in Starbound, is to provide protection and add passive skills to statistics, such increasing health, regeneration of energy or heat. Each kind of armor has its own bonuses and statistics. Some of the armors are better for short range combat (high protection), whereas the other are preferred for ranged combat (high energy/regeneration of energy).

Armors are not generated by the game and they do not have random statistics, just like in the case of weapons. You can find them underground,, in chests, buy from merchants or craft on your own.

Armors are divided into 4 modules, each one with its own slot:

  • Head- you can find hats, helmets and bandanas, etc. here. They provide bonuses to energy, defense and heat.
  • Chest-the entire part that you wear on to the chest and shoulders. Provide bonuses to health, defense and heat.
  • Pants - covers the character's legs and feet. Provide bonuses to health regeneration, defense and heat.
  • Back- all sorts of backpacks, coats etc. here. It can perform purely aesthetic functions or provide you with special abilities, like e.g. glowing in dark or more larger inventory.

Armors can be divided into several types: Clothing, Basic armor, Racial armor and Vanity armor. All of them have been described in the following sub-chapters.

Clothing

Clothing is the basic type of armor and, at the same time, the weakest one. Each character starts in the race clothes, selected in the character selection screen. The clothes sets are identical, when it comes to statistics and they only differ in looks.

Each element of the basic apparel requires 20x Fabric and the Yarn Spinner. You can also color the clothes with an appropriate Dye.

Basic armor

The basic armors that can be crafted with the ores available I the Alpha sector. All of the armors are identical, for each one of the races, and they have the same statistics. They also are an ingredient for the high-level racial armors, like e.g. the Copper Armor is required to craft the Iron Armor.

Racial armor

Racial armors can be crafted from one of the 10 types of the level irons. Each race has 10 sets of such armors, with their own style and passive abilities for the full set.

At the beginning of the game, you can only craft the armors of your own race but, with time, you can discover the armors of the remaining races and craft them also.

Special bonuses for the full sets of racial armors:

  • Apex: Increases the speed of running and the height of jumping.
  • Avian: provides the ability to glide in the air.
  • Floran: turns sunray s into energy.
  • Glitch: increases the speed of digging and mining for ores.
  • Human: Increases the size of the backpack.
  • Hylotl: increases the speed of swimming and allows you to breathe underwater.

Vanity armor

Vanity armor are the armors that perform the aesthetic functions. You can place them in the vanity slot, to get the appropriate looks without removing the old armor.

Some of the decorative elements of the armors have special bonuses. For example: Oxygen Tank enables you to breath underwater and in the space and the Lantern Stick illuminates the surrounding, without the necessity to activate the flashlight or the torch. The majority of them, however, are only for the looks.
